This summer, the National Museum of American History has opened up its collection for a research experience like never before! Through the Travel Research in Equity Collections (TREC) program, the Smithsonian is looking for four new researchers, journalists, artists, film-makers, writers, or scholars for a 10 day, expense paid ($1,500 lump sum) research trip to the archives of NMAH. As the research is based around the subjects of disability, LGBTQ, gender, sexuality, and race/ethnicity, potential applicants will be asked to submit a resume and other documents pertinent to the applicants future research. The application deadline is July 15, 2016 and awards will be announced on August 15, 2016!
